Eastern And Oriental Hotel

Eastern And Oriental Hotel

8/10 Good
"This iconic hotel is well located and within walking distance to restaurants and tourist spots and where we stayed at the Victory Annex - fantastic sea views from the suites. Of course the super hot weather would probably deter most people from walking any where and a grab ride costs just a few bucks in your choice of car. The suites are big, ours faced the sea and we had a balcony which made for catching the first light a pleasure when we woke up each morning. The ceilings of the rooms were spectacularly high and the bathroom was almost too big. Really liked the "his and hers" sinks separated by a walk way (so i could clutter mine and hubby could keep his minimalist :D). The breakfast at Sarkies - lots of variety, our favourites were the individually fried plates of char kway teow and the roti canai with your choice of fillings. I would stay again just for the breakfast. Then why 4 stars - for some reason, we could get the AC the temperature we wanted - it was either too cold or not cold enough. Prob our user error. The bath - when we ran the water, it wasn't clear...? The shower was great though. Would i stay again - maybe - we might try the heritage wing to compare. But definitely give it a go - the hotel runs really good deals and includes breakfast and that already makes all the difference."

When can I expect good weather in Batu Maung?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Batu Maung rel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ually March and May,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 27°C. The rainiest months in Batu Maung are November, October, December and May, with each month seeing an average of 335 mm of rainfall.
What's there to see and do in Batu Maung?
Take in the sights and attractions that Batu Maung offers with a visit to Pantai Kapor Bakar, Bukit Teluk Tempoyak Besar and Bukit Payung. If you have extra time while you're in the area, you might want to see Penang International Sports Arena and Queensbay Mall.
